Diminishing liquidity in modern corporations can be attributed to increased capital expenditures and investments in long-term assets, which tie up cash resources. Additionally, companies often maintain lean inventory levels to optimize efficiency, reducing the cash available for immediate use. Furthermore, the shift towards more complex financial structures and reliance on debt can also limit liquidity by increasing obligations and reducing available cash flow.

The main reason that almost all large companies are corporations is due to the limited liability protection they offer to shareholders. This structure allows individuals to invest in the company without risking personal assets beyond their investment in the corporation. Additionally, corporations can raise capital more easily through the sale of stock, which is crucial for growth and expansion. The corporate structure also provides advantages in terms of governance, continuity, and tax benefits.

Corporations are generally much easier to sell and are usually more attractive to buyers than either a sole proprietorship or partnership. The reason for this is because a new buyer will not be personally liable for any wrongdoings on the part of the previous owners. If someone buys a sole proprietorship, for example, the new owner can be held personally liable for any mistakes or illegalities on the part of the prior owner…even if the new owner had NOTHING to do with the situation! This is usually NOT the case with a corporation.

Liquidity means a bank is able to pay its financial obligations. The main cause of liquidity problems comes about because of constantly changing deposit amounts. This is one reason it's in a bank's best interest to offer customers perks to sign up for direct deposit. With the above noted, the primary cause of liquidity problems in commercial banks relates to that institution's unsuccessful business strategies. Along with this we often find far too many nonperforming loans. This normally means that the bank has not done good work in their research and their credit departments need to revamp on the criteria they set for making loans.
